Bitmain's Antminer T9: A Miner's Guide to Effective Cryptocurrency Mining
Apr 15, 2024 at 01:55 am
Bitmain's Antminer T9 series provides miners with a comprehensive solution for Bitcoin mining. Featuring an impressive hash rate of up to 10.5 TH/s, the T9 ensures efficient and profitable mining operations. With optimized energy efficiency, low power consumption of approximately 1,375 watts, and an efficiency rating of 0.13 J/GH, miners can maximize profitability while minimizing energy expenses.

Bitmain's Antminer T9: A Comprehensive Guide for Effective Cryptocurrency Mining
Introduction
Bitmain, a leading manufacturer in the cryptocurrency mining hardware industry, has consistently provided miners with innovative and efficient solutions for mining Bitcoin (BTC) and other SHA-256-based cryptocurrencies. The Antminer T9, a flagship product in Bitmain's Antminer series, has garnered significant attention due to its robust performance, energy efficiency, and ease of use. This comprehensive guide delves into the details of the Antminer T9, empowering miners with the knowledge to maximize their mining operations effectively.
Features and Specifications
1. Exceptional Hash Rate: The Antminer T9's core strength lies in its remarkable hash rate, a critical determinant of a miner's profitability. With a hash rate of up to 10.5 TH/s (terahashes per second), the Antminer T9 swiftly and accurately confirms transactions on the Bitcoin network, solving intricate cryptographic riddles that reward miners with Bitcoin.
2. Energy Efficiency: In addition to its high hash rate, the Antminer T9 boasts exceptional energy efficiency, allowing miners to increase their profitability by minimizing energy consumption. Consuming approximately 1,375 watts of power while delivering an efficiency rating of 0.13 J/GH (joules per gigahash), the Antminer T9 ensures that miners can mine Bitcoin profitably, even in regions with higher electricity costs.
3. Remote Management and Monitoring: The Antminer T9 offers robust remote management and monitoring capabilities, providing miners with enhanced flexibility and convenience. Utilizing Bitmain's mining management software, miners can remotely monitor and control their Antminer T9 devices from any location with internet access, ensuring optimal performance and troubleshooting efficiency.
Comprehensive Guide to Using the Antminer T9
1. Unboxing and Setup:
- Unpack the Antminer T9 and verify that all components are present and undamaged.
- Attach the Power Supply Unit (PSU) to the Antminer T9 using the provided cables, ensuring that the PSU meets the minimum power requirements of the Antminer T9.
- Connect the Antminer T9 to the local network using an Ethernet cable.
2. Accessing the Web Interface:
- Power on the Antminer T9 using the PSU's power switch.
- Allow the device to boot up, and once it has initialized, the display will show its IP address.
- Launch a web browser on a computer, type the Antminer T9's IP address into the address bar, and press Enter to access the web interface.
3. Configuring Pool Settings:
- Navigate to the "Miner Configuration" or "Pool Settings" section of the web interface.
- Enter the relevant information for your chosen mining pool, including the URL, worker login, and worker password. This information can be obtained from the mining pool's website.
- Save the pool settings after making the necessary adjustments.
4. Setting Mining Parameters:
- Open the web interface and navigate to the "Miner Configuration" or "Advanced Settings" section.
- Adjust the mining parameters, such as voltage and frequency (clock speed), to optimize stability and performance.
- Save the settings after making the adjustments.
Note: It is recommended to start with the default settings and make gradual adjustments while monitoring the device's performance in the Miner Configuration.
5. Monitoring Mining Performance:
- To monitor the Antminer T9's mining performance, navigate to the "System Monitor" or "Status" section of the web interface.
- Check the hash rate, temperature, and fan speed to ensure that the device is operating within optimal parameters.
- Monitor the mining pool's website or dashboard to track mining performance and earnings over time.
6. Troubleshooting and Maintenance:
- Regularly inspect the Antminer T9 for dust and debris accumulation. Use compressed air or a soft brush to clean the device and its fans to prevent overheating and performance issues.
- Monitor the fan speed and device temperature consistently. Investigate and resolve any potential issues promptly if temperatures rise above recommended ranges or fan speeds exhibit abnormalities.
- Stay updated with software and firmware releases from Bitmain. Install updates as available to ensure security, compatibility, and enhanced performance.
